Creating key message points regarding implementing health reform is an important skill. Before the public health community can effectively do this it is important to understand the public’s views on the topic. This session will discuss communicating health reform implementation from the public’s point of view.
Session Objectives: 1. discuss how to successfully communicate about health reform and its implementation to the public, policymakers, and opnion leaders 2. formulate communication materials
